Description

The integrated LED wall wash lamp with luminous intensity distribution
Technical field
The utility model is related to a kind of LED wall wash lamp of the integration with luminous intensity distribution.
Background technology
The wall lamp structure for circulating in the market mainly includes:Lamp body, the LED light source component on lamp body, cover The light-distribution lens that are located on each LED/light source, diffuser or tempering glass lid that sealing function is played on lamp body surface are covered, this Plant needs to be fixed by screw between each part of structure, and installation procedure is more, and sealing reliability is poor, and lens die is fabricated to This height, and the construction cycle is long, lens unit is high with LED positioning accuracy requests, under poly-lens volume and spacing restriction, LED chip Arrangement density is low.
The problems referred to above are the problems that should be paid attention to and solve in design with production process.

Specific embodiment
Describe preferred embodiment of the present utility model in detail below in conjunction with the accompanying drawings.
Embodiment one
A kind of LED wall wash lamp of the integration with luminous intensity distribution, such as Fig. 1 and Fig. 2, Fig. 3, including lamp body 2, light source assembly, driving group Part 5, mounting bracket 8, the two ends of lamp body 2 are respectively installed with the first end cap 11 and the second end cap 12, if light source assembly include substrate 3 and Dry LED chip 4, LED chip 4 is configured on the substrate 3, and lamp body 2 is provided with support using integrated lamp body 2, the inside side walls of lamp body 2 Frame, and it is to be provided with drive component 5, light-source chamber in relatively independent driving chamber 7, light-source chamber, driving chamber 7 that bracing frame separates lamp body 2 Light source assembly is inside provided with, the inwall of light-source chamber is provided with the equipped draw-in groove 6 being oppositely arranged, is equipped with difference clamp substrate 3 in draw-in groove 6 Both sides, the bottom of lamp body 2 is provided with slip draw-in groove 10, and the top of lamp body 2 is provided with lens bar 1, such as Fig. 4, mounting bracket 8 be provided with for The fixed concave edge 9 of positioning in insertion slip draw-in groove 10.
LED wall wash lamp of this kind of integration with luminous intensity distribution, lamp body 2 reduces production assemble flow using integrated lamp body 2, Process is simple, improves light fixture degree of protection, and lamp body 2 adopts integrated extrusion molding, lamp body 2 to seal with lens bar 1, bracing frame Property more preferably, water proof and dust proof effect is more excellent.Bracing frame is independently divided with driving chamber 7 by light-source chamber, can solve the problem that heat dissipation problem, it is to avoid Heat is concentrated affects service life.Mounting bracket 8 is fixed with the buckle-type of lamp body 2 positioning, and whole lamp can be facilitated to be arranged on different making With in environment.Mounting bracket 8 is connected with the buckle-type of lamp body 2, and whole lamp is easy to install, overcomes LED in the market and washes wall The deficiency of lamp.
Such as Fig. 2, lens bar 1 includes planar portions 101 and curved portions 102, the both sides of planar portions 101 respectively with the top of lamp body 2 End connection, curved portions 102 are connected located at the middle part of planar portions 101, one end of curved portions 102 with planar portions 101, curved portions 102 The other end be provided with Baltimore groove 103, is provided with LED chip 4 in Baltimore groove 103.LED/light source light-focusing type after lens bar 1 is more preferable, Irradiated scope can more be projected, it is adaptable to the lighting engineering of the occasion such as lamp hotel, bridge, street.
The substrate 3 of light source assembly is corresponding with the length of lens bar 1, the bottom surface phase of planar portions 101 of substrate 3 and lens bar 1 It is parallel, and arbitrary LED chip 4 is centrally located on the axis of the luminous intensity distribution part cross section on substrate 3.The substrate of light source assembly 3 conveniently insertion lamp body 2 spill can be equipped with draw-in groove 6, and firmly spacing in upper-lower position, and structure is closely.
LED chip 4 is using common white light source LED chip 4 or RGB-LED light source chips 4.Such as Fig. 2, LED chip 4 is in base It is arranged in a light source cell on plate 3, the curved portions 102 that every light source cell piece has lens bar 1 are corresponded.Thoroughly Mirror bar 1 using light-focusing type lens bar 1 or astigmatism type lens bar 1, using transparent material made by lens bar 1, lamp body 2 and bracing frame Made using opaque material.Lens bar 1 is made using polycarbonate, polymetylmethacrylate or polystyrene PS Lens bar 1.First end cap 11 is provided with the socket aperture being connected with power supply, and socket aperture is provided with and is connected with the input of drive component 5 Wire.
